Unraveling the Mystery

Suppose you’ve noticed that your Google ranking keeps fluctuating, and you’re left wondering why; you’re not alone. This comprehensive blog post will explore the reasons behind these changes and provide valuable insights to help you better understand and optimize your website’s position in search results. We’ll cover topics like algorithm updates, content quality, and competition while integrating relevant keywords, case studies, and external sources to support our points.

Google Algorithm Updates

KeyStar SEO Agency Logo

KeyStar Agency Logo

One of the primary reasons for fluctuations in your Google ranking is the constant updates to Google’s search algorithm. Google adjusts its algorithm to deliver better search results, which may cause your website’s position to change. These updates can range from minor tweaks to significant overhauls, like the Panda or Penguin updates, that target specific issues, such as low-quality content or spammy backlinks.

Example: A well-known case study on Google’s algorithm updates is the rollout of the Mobilegeddon update in 2015. This update prioritized mobile-friendly websites, causing non-mobile-friendly sites to drop in search rankings. For more information on Google algorithm updates, visit Moz‘s comprehensive list of Google updates.

Content Quality and Relevance

Another factor that impacts your Google ranking is the quality and relevance of your content. Websites with high-quality, fresh, and engaging content that answers users’ queries will typically rank higher than those with outdated or poorly written content. You may notice fluctuations in your search rankings and traffic dropping if your content needs to improve.

Keyword research ensures that your content is relevant to your target audience. Tools like Google Keyword Planner or Ubersuggest can help you identify the right keywords to focus on.

Competition in the SERPs

Your website’s Google ranking can also be affected by the performance of competing websites. As new content is published and older content is updated, the competition in the search engine results pages (SERPs) can intensify. If your competitors are creating better content or optimizing their websites more effectively, it can lead to fluctuations in your ranking.

Example: A case study by Ahrefs showcased how a website managed to outrank its competition by analyzing competitors’ content, identifying gaps, and creating superior content that addressed them.

User Behavior and Personalized Search Results

Google’s search results are personalized based on a user’s search history, location, and device. These personalized search results can cause fluctuations in your website’s ranking, as different users may see different results.

An illustration comparing personalized search results for the same query from two users

To learn more about personalized search results, visit this article by Google.  For tips on optimizing your content for SEO, check out our blog post on “Why Do My Google Rankings Suddenly Drop.”

Are you ready to take control of your website’s Google ranking? Contact our team of expert SEO consultants today for a personalized strategy to help you stay ahead of the competition.

We aim to provide valuable insights and actionable steps to improve your website’s Google ranking while keeping the content informative, interesting, and reader-friendly.

A visual representation of the correlation between content quality and search engine rankings, highlighting the importance of creating engaging and relevant content.

A visual representation of the correlation between content quality and search engine rankings, highlighting the importance of creating engaging and relevant content.


Higher content quality leads to better search engine rankings.

SEO-Optimized Tips for Stability in Google Rankings

While fluctuations in Google rankings are common, following these SEO-optimized tips can help you maintain stability and improve your website’s position over time:

  1. Regularly update your content: Keep it fresh and relevant by updating it regularly. This can help you stay ahead of your competition and maintain a strong position in search rankings.
  2. Monitor and analyze your competitors: Stay informed about what your competitors are doing regarding content and SEO strategy. This will help you identify opportunities for improvement and stay ahead of the game.
  3. Build high-quality backlinks: Focus on earning backlinks from reputable websites to increase your website’s authority and search engine rankings.
  4. Optimize and test Google page speed and mobile devices: Google prioritizes websites that load quickly and are mobile-friendly. Ensure your website is up to speed and responsive on all devices.
  5. Engage in keyword research: Regularly research and target relevant keywords to ensure your content reaches your desired audience.
  6. Utilize structured data markup: By adding structured data markup, you can improve your visibility in rich search results, such as featured snippets and knowledge panels.
  7. Focus on user experience (UX): A positive user experience keeps visitors on your site longer and signals to Google that your website can be trusted and is valuable and relevant to users. Pay attention to factors like site navigation, readability, and visual appeal.
  8. Engage with your audience: Encourage user interaction through comments, social media shares, and feedback. This will create a sense of community, increase user engagement, and boost your website’s search rankings.
  9. Monitor your website’s performance: Regularly track your website’s performance using SEO tools like Google Analytics, Search Console or from this SEO tools list. This will help you identify any issues or areas that need improvement and make data-driven decisions to optimize your SEO strategy.
  10. Stay up-to-date with industry news and algorithm updates: It’s essential to stay informed about the latest trends, best practices, and algorithm updates. Subscribe to industry blogs, attend webinars, and join SEO forums to keep your knowledge current.
  11. Diversify your content strategy: To keep your audience engaged and improve your search rankings, consider diversifying your content strategy. Include various formats like blog posts, videos, infographics, and podcasts to cater to user preferences and keep your website fresh.
  12. Optimize on-page SEO elements: Ensure that elements, such as header tags, title tags, meta descriptions, and, are optimized with relevant keywords and accurately represent your content. By doing this, you will help search engines better understand your content and improve your visibility in search results.
  13. Invest in local SEO: If you run a location-based business, invest in local SEO by optimizing your Google My Business profile, creating location-specific content, and earning local backlinks. This will help you rank higher in local search results and attract more customers from your target area.
  14. Leverage social media: While social media may not directly impact your search rankings, it can help your online visibility and drive more people to your website. Share your content on social media platforms, engage with your audience, and build a solid online presence to enhance your overall SEO efforts.
  15. Implement a strong internal linking strategy: By creating a robust internal linking structure, you can help search engines better understand the hierarchy of your website and improve your site’s crawl ability. Internal links also help guide users to other relevant content on your website, increasing their time on the site and boosting your SEO performance.
  16. Focus on long-tail keywords: Targeting long-tail keywords can help your ranking in search results, as these specific phrases often have lower competition and higher conversion rates. Creating content around long-tail keywords can attract a more targeted audience and improve your website’s overall search performance.
  17. Foster high-quality external backlinks: Besides earning backlinks from reputable websites, build relationships with industry influencers and bloggers to garner high-quality external backlinks. Guest blogging, collaborations, and strategic partnerships can help you earn valuable backlinks and enhance your website’s authority.
  18. Conduct regular SEO audits: Regularly auditing your website’s SEO performance can help you identify any weaknesses, errors, or areas that need improvement. By conducting SEO audits, you can ensure that your website remains optimized and aligned with current best practices.
  19. Encourage user-generated content: User-generated content, such as social media posts, testimonials, and reviews, can help improve your website’s search performance by providing fresh content and social proof. Encourage your audience to contribute by creating opportunities for interaction and feedback.
  20. Be patient and persistent: SEO is a long-term strategy that requires patience and persistence. Don’t expect immediate results; focus on implementing solid SEO strategy services and refining your approach. Over time, your efforts will pay off, and you’ll see improvements in your website’s search performance.


A visual representation of the factors affecting your Google rankings, emphasizing the importance of a holistic approach to SEO

A visual representation of the factors affecting your Google rankings, emphasizing the importance of a holistic approach to SEO


A comprehensive SEO strategy can help you maintain stability in Google rankings.

Are you ready to take your website to the next level? Schedule a consultation with our expert team today to unlock your website’s potential. Together, we’ll create a bespoke SEO strategy that drives growth and success in the ever-changing world of search engine rankings.

recovery from Google website traffic organic drops

Case Study Screenshot Examples of Sudden Organic Traffic Drop Recovery

A well-rounded SEO strategy is the key to maintaining stability in Google rankings.

Don’t let fluctuations in Google rankings hold you back. Unlock your website’s full potential and achieve long-lasting success with our expert guidance and support. Contact our experienced SEO professionals today, and let’s work together to create a custom strategy that drives results and keeps your website at the top of search engine rankings.


Patience is a key element of success

A graphical quote illustrating the importance of patience and persistence in SEO


SEO success requires consistent effort and a long-term approach.

By implementing these additional strategies, you can improve your website’s search performance and achieve stability in your Google rankings. The key to success is a holistic approach to SEO, focusing on both on-page and off-page optimization, user experience, and continuous learning.

Understanding why your Google ranking keeps changing is crucial to developing an effective SEO strategy. Use relevant keywords, incorporate examples or case studies, and reference external sources to enhance your content. By staying informed about algorithm updates, focusing on content quality and relevance, and keeping an eye on your competition, you can improve your website’s position in the SERPs.

ever changing symbol

Why Does My Google Ranking Keep Changing

Are you ready to take your website’s SEO to new heights?

Reach out to our team of professional SEO consultants today for a personalized consultation, and let’s work together to create a results-driven strategy that propels you to the top of search engine rankings. Experience the difference expert guidance and support can make in your journey toward long-lasting SEO success.

Recent Posts